Evaluating the Drought Code Using In Situ Drying Timelags of Feathermoss Duff in Interior Alaska
The Drought Code (DC) is a moisture code of the Canadian Forest Fire Weather Index System underlain by a hydrological water balance model in which drying occurs in a negative exponential pattern with a relatively long timelag.
